Jarrett Dapier

Born:
Connection to Illinois: Dapier is a teen services librarian at Skokie Public Library. He lives in Evanston.

Biography: Jarrett Dapier is a children's book author, librarian, and lifelong drummer. He is the recipient of the 2016 John Phillip Immroth Memorial Award for Intellectual Freedom from the American Library Association for his research which uncovered previously suppressed information about the 2013 censorship of Marjane Satrapi's graphic novel Persepolis in Chicago Public Schools. His first graphic novel – Wake Now in the Fire – is based on this research and will be released by Chronicle Books in 2023.

Jazz for Lunch!
ISBN: 153445408X OCLC: 1150834835

Atheneum/Caitlyn Dlouhy Books 2021

After lunch at a very crowded jazz cafe, a boy and his Auntie Nina are inspired to create a feast of their own with such treats as Thelonious Monk Fish and Nat King Cole Slaw.

Mr. Watson's Chickens
ISBN: 1452177147 OCLC: 1233024628

Chronicle Books 2021

Mr. Watson loves his three chickens, and every morning he and Mr. Nelson count them; but when they start to multiply, his house and tiny yard are soon overrun, and the noise and mess are driving Mr. Nelson crazy--so the couple set out to find a new home for the chickens.
